As those who know me know I like the ornamental onions of all kinds and sizes. There is one called A. flavum which is a foot tall candelabra type flower with grey/green leaves and yellow flowers. It is an eastern European species. There is a variation called A.f. tauricum which is pink and white too.
These are seedlings of the norma' yellow one (the first image in picture number one). There are other variations too,but they are not yet open enough to photo.
